350TPI Engine Swap wiring
Hello, I am currently in the process of swapping a 350 TPI into my 1991 RS from the 305. I am in need of a wiring harness for the motor to replace the factory one that is cut. I found a standalone harness on Classic Industries and was wondering if that would be a viable option?
This is the link: https://www.classicindustries.com/pr...E&gclsrc=aw.ds
If I am to purchase this harness, is there anything else I would need to go along with it or is it plug and play? I do fortunately have the ECM from the original car that the 350 is from. The ECM and motor are out of a 1992 Z28.

Re: 350TPI Engine Swap wiring
60203 is longer and would probably go through the fender pass through hole. If you want a 60103 check this out
https://tunedperformance.org/store/p...pi-harness-ecm
you could always get a used 90-92 tpi or tbi harness. The tbi harness can be repinned to the 730 ecm. You still should use the Vss buffer from tbi and optical input of the 730 to get tcc and speedometer to work.

Re: 350TPI Engine Swap wiring
89 is tpi maf, 90-92 uses the 1227730 and is speed density. Not sure what to recommend. A used harness can be hit or miss with broken connector and cut wires.

Re: 350TPI Engine Swap wiring
The speedometer gets a Vss signal from the yellow buffer box through c207 connector. The ecm also needs a signal through its optical input so the programming flag needs to be switched. If it was my car I’d strip the Vss and buffer wiring and reinstall
